  • COMSTECH International Seminar On Neglected Tropical Diseases

    Introduction:

    OIC-COMSTECH is pleased to announce an International Seminar on Neglected Tropical Diseases (NTDs), addressing critical global health challenges affecting vulnerable populations across Africa, Asia, and the Americas.NTDs comprise a group of 20 infectious diseases caused by viruses, bacteria, protozoa, and parasitic worms. With the impact of climate change and global warming, these diseases are increasingly spreading beyond tropical regions into temperate climates.

    A special focus of this seminar will be Leishmaniasis, one of the top ten NTDs worldwide, affecting more than 12 million people globally. In this seminar, a team of internationally renowned speakers will discuss diagnostics of NTDs, structure-based and AI supported drug discovery targeting the Leishmaniasis causing parasites.

    About the Event

    OIC-COMSTECH, in collaboration with SAWiE Ecosystems Ltd., is organizing an International Roundtable and Technical Dialogue on “Unlocking Agricultural Carbon Markets: Climate-Smart Solutions for a Resilient Future.”

    Agriculture remains central to food security, livelihoods, exports and economic growth across Pakistan and many OIC member states. At the same time, agricultural activities—including rice cultivation, livestock, synthetic fertilizer use and on-farm energy consumption—contribute significantly to greenhouse gas emissions. The transition towards climate-smart and low-carbon agriculture therefore presents both a challenge and an important opportunity.

    The Roundtable will explore how climate-smart agriculture, nature-based solutions, regenerative agriculture and carbon-market mechanisms can help reduce emissions while maintaining agricultural productivity, improving resilience, strengthening export competitiveness and creating new opportunities for farmers and other stakeholders.

    Background:

    Rapid urbanization and climate change are reshaping cities across the world, particularly in OIC Member States where growing populations continue to place increasing pressure on infrastructure, natural resources, and essential public services. Rising greenhouse gas emissions, unsustainable construction practices, urban heat, flooding, air pollution, and declining green spaces have made climate resilience a priority for sustainable urban development.

    To address these challenges, OIC-COMSTECH, under the Forum on Environment and Ecosystem Restoration (CFEER), is organizing an online seminar on “Building Climate Resilient Smart Cities for a Sustainable Future.” The seminar will bring together researchers, policymakers, practitioners, and students to explore innovative strategies, digital technologies, and collaborative approaches for developing smarter, more inclusive, and climate-resilient cities across OIC Member and Observer States.

    Introduction:

    Artificial Intelligence is changing the way software-intensive systems are designed, built, and maintained. As AI components become a standard part of engineering solutions, sound software engineering principles need to be paired with methods specific to AI. OIC-COMSTECH is organizing a two-day training course on “Engineering of AI Driven Systems” to give researchers and faculty members from OIC Member and Observer States a practical grounding in how to engineer AI-driven systems.

    Importance:

    As AI moves from experimental use into mission-critical deployments, conventional software engineering practices on their own are no longer enough to guarantee quality, safety, and reliability. Engineering AI-driven systems calls for its own discipline – one that accounts for data-driven behavior, changing requirements, and the integration of AI components into larger systems. This course walks participants through that discipline across the AI system lifecycle, from requirements to design, development, and deployment, and contributes to building this capacity within institutions across OIC Member States.
